Output 6017f26b90803677fa37abf813d881cb7c2f6c4bcab558a09430dbb5e566ae12:1

value
519383203
script pubkey
OP_0 OP_PUSHBYTES_20 e9dc7680c9f2c22a49607749979e3fa39f45a839
address
ltc1qa8w8dqxf7tpz5jtqwaye083l5w05t2perdnr4w
transaction
6017f26b90803677fa37abf813d881cb7c2f6c4bcab558a09430dbb5e566ae12
spent
true